RSA Appoints Patswa as New CFO for Scandinavian Business
RSA announced that it has appointed Stig Pastwa as Chief Financial Officer for its Scandinavian business, which includes operations in Denmark, Sweden and Norway and the Codan and Trygg-Hansa brands, effective as of May 1st, 2015.
He will be responsible for operating and developing the finance function across the region and will report directly to Patrick Bergander, CEO of Scandinavia. Patswa has over 28 years financial experience having held CFO roles at DSB, the largest train operator in Scandinavia, and AP Moller-Maersk.
Bergander welcomed Patswa to RSA, noting his “significant amount of international experience from a range of sectors and blue chip organizations.”
